This year Hip-Hop celebrates its 50th anniversary as a genre. You can’t talk about hip-hop and not talk about the influence that Jamaican sound culture played on hip-hop as a genre. DJ Kool Herc, who is of Jamaican descent popularized playing records is between one another, using two record players. This music playing technique became the backbone of the movement in the late 70s and early 80s. While DJ Kool Herc isn’t the only accredited foundation member there are definitely other influences like R&B, Disco and poetry also contributed to the genre. In this episode, we discuss the connections and growth trajectory.
